‘Moonlighting’ leads to surge in home based businesses

An article in today’s Sunday Times refers to thousands of professionals – “lawyers, financial advisers, computer programmers and marketing managers” - who are looking for freelance work outside of normal office hours. We see this as a welcome first step to thousands more home based businesses.

The article, written by Robert Watts, refers to research from Capital Economics showing an extra 56,000 people who are “exploiting their job skills to earn extra cash” – you can bet your bottom dollar they’re exploiting these skills from an office that’s called home. 

The piece goes on to quote friend of Enterprise Nation and founder of freelance site www.peopleperhour.com, Xenios Thrasyvoulou, who says: “we have a lot of people who say they are under-used at work and can go online and find extra to do.”

The final quote comes from Avon (who have more reps running a home business than the personnel count of the British Army) and attracted 17,000 new recruits in the past year alone.

This all bodes well for home business in the UK.
